🛏️ Sleep Essentials

A Safe, Portable Crib

Your newborn will sleep up to 17 hours a day, so a safe, comfortable sleep space is non-negotiable. Look for a crib that's adjustable in height (so you can easily lift baby without straining your back), breathable mesh sides for airflow, and foldable for when you travel or move between rooms.

Why It Matters:

A foldable crib or bassinet is perfect for the early months because it:

  • Keeps your baby close for nighttime feeding
  • Saves space (great for smaller rooms)
  • Is portable for easy movement around the house

💡 Pro Tip: Choose a breathable design with good ventilation to reduce overheating.

Swaddle Blankets

Swaddling mimics the snug feeling of the womb and helps newborns sleep longer and more soundly. Muslin is the gold standard — it's breathable, gets softer with every wash, and works year-round.

Why It Matters:

Muslin swaddles are lightweight, breathable, and versatile. They can be used for:

  • Swaddling
  • Burping cloths
  • Nursing covers
  • Light blankets

💡 Pro Tip: Go for soft, pre-washed muslin to avoid skin irritation.

🛁 Bathing Essentials

A Non-Slip Baby Bath Seat

Bathing a slippery newborn solo can feel nerve-wracking. A wrap-around bath seat with suction cups keeps baby secure and your hands free to wash and rinse safely.

✔️ What You Need:

  • Foldable Baby Bath Seat
  • Mild baby soap
  • Soft washcloths
  • Hooded towels (2–3)

Why It Matters:

A foldable bath seat:

  • Supports your baby securely
  • Reduces slipping risks
  • Saves space when not in use

💡 Pro Tip: Bathe your newborn 2–3 times a week—overbathing can dry their delicate skin.

🧸 Comfort & Play

A Soft Play Mat

Even in the first weeks, tummy time on a safe, cushioned surface is essential for building neck and core strength. A double-sided foam mat gives you a clean, padded space for play and tummy time from day one.

What You Can Skip (For Now)

  • ❌ Baby shoes — newborns don't walk; socks are enough
  • ❌ Elaborate nursery décor — baby doesn't care, and you'll be too tired to notice
  • ❌ Wipe warmers, bottle sterilizer UV gadgets, and other "nice to have" extras
  • ❌ Dozens of outfits in newborn size — babies outgrow them in weeks
